你查询的IP:[59.191.5.32]  地理位置:中国–广东

最新查询221.192.247.60 116.128.98.252 58.16.40.91 218.104.11.111 60.247.61.174 122.96.35.11 221.129.20.3 59.151.20.161 121.58.59.68 59.191.5.32 121.52.160.171 122.64.1.191 203.95.96.185 203.99.16.242 203.100.32.163 203.100.32.149 124.16.138.80 119.164.155.25 202.38.146.115 221.198.188.133 202.160.176.42 118.242.181.70 116.252.118.125 117.120.64.196 119.44.114.170 124.126.177.227 203.156.192.191 202.74.8.199 118.224.74.193 221.12.128.169 119.28.225.56